I put Nexen Roadian AT Pro RA8 on instead (they were on sale and had white letter sidewalls, I am old school) and honestly I haven't regretted it at all... I do some off-roading and deal with pretty severe winters and snow and the Nexens have been very good in those conditions and I have put a fair amount of interstate highway miles on them and they run nice and quiet.

I've put these on my work vans and personal trucks for years, I've used about 6 sets. They punch way above their weight. I'm not going to say they're the best, but they're better than they have any reason to be considering the price. They wear long, are reasonably quiet and work well plowing snow.
